Method & references

Cardiac — T2* (1.5 T)

Fe (mg/g) = 45 × T2*−1.22

Acceptable myocardial iron is defined as T2* > 20 ms.

Liver — T2* (1.5 T)

Fe (mg/g) = 25.4 / T2* + 0.202

Liver — R2* (1.5 T)

T2* = 1000 / R2* Fe (mg/g) = 25.4 / T2* + 0.202

Liver — T2* (3.0 T)

T2*_eff = 2 / (1/T2* + 11/1000) Fe (mg/g) = 25.4 / T2*_eff + 0.202

Liver — R2* (3.0 T)

T2* = 1000 / R2* T2*_eff = 2 / (1/T2* + 11/1000) Fe (mg/g) = 25.4 / T2*_eff + 0.202

μmol Fe/g = mg Fe/g × 17.907 (Fe molar mass). Severity bands below apply to hepatic μmol Fe/g.

Severityµmol Fe/gmg Fe/g (dry)
Normal< 37< 2.0
Mild37 – 1502.1 – 8.4
Moderate151 – 3008.4 – 16.8
Severe> 300> 16.8

References

  1. Anderson LJ. Assessment of iron overload with T2* magnetic resonance imaging. Prog Cardiovasc Dis. 2011;54(3):287–94.
  2. Carpenter JP, et al. On T2* magnetic resonance and cardiac iron. Circulation. 2011;123(14):1519–28.
  3. Wood JC, et al. MRI R2 and R2* mapping accurately estimates hepatic iron concentration in transfusion-dependent thalassemia and sickle cell disease patients. Blood. 2005;106(4):1460–5.
  4. Storey P, et al. R2* imaging of transfusional iron burden at 3T and comparison with 1.5T. J Magn Reson Imaging. 2007;25(3):540–7.
